8 minutes ago, Horus said:

Don't think so. I remember Ronaldo having a billion dollar release clause when he went to Madrid. Unless they've changed the process over the last few years, it's always been an agreement between club and player. 

This is what ESPN says about it. I don't know how they define proportional. 

 

How is the value of the clause decided?

Sanchez-Bote: The law states that release clauses should be proportional to the salary of the player. The value should be clearly stated in the contract signed by both sides, the player and the club, and be freely agreed by both sides.
